Gather Necessary Tools and Supplies

Before you can successfully connect your air compressor to a hose reel, you will need to gather the necessary tools and supplies. Firstly, you will need a compressor hose, which can be purchased at most hardware stores. Check to ensure that the hose you buy is compatible with your air compressor’s fittings.

Additionally, you may need some Teflon tape, pliers, and a wrench to properly connect everything. Teflon tape helps to seal the connections and prevent leaks, while pliers and a wrench are necessary for tightening and loosening the fittings as needed. It’s important to have all of these items on hand before getting started to ensure a smooth and successful installation process.

Factors to consider when selecting a hose reel for your compressor

When selecting a hose reel for your compressor, there are various factors you must consider to make the right choice. Firstly, the size of the reel should match the length and diameter of the hose to prevent tangling. Secondly, consider the environment where you’ll be operating your compressor.

If the location is dusty or has high foot traffic, a hose reel with an enclosed design may be suitable. Thirdly, the type of material used to make the reel should be durable and resistant to wear and tear. Materials such as steel or heavy-duty plastic ensure long-lasting use.

Lastly, consider the overall quality of the hose reel, including its accessories and features, such as adjustable tension, easy mounting, and safety features. With these factors in mind, you’ll be able to choose the right hose reel that fits your needs and budget, ensuring safe and efficient compressor operation.

Attach the Hose Reel to the Wall

Connecting your air compressor to a hose reel is an essential step for any workshop or garage. The first step is to attach the hose reel to the wall. You’ll need to make sure the wall is sturdy enough to support the weight of the reel and the air hose.

Using screws and anchors, mount the reel to the wall securely. You should use at least four screws at the corners of the bracket to ensure stability. Next, connect the air hose to the hose reel using the provided fittings.

It’s essential to make sure the fittings are securely attached to prevent any leaks. Once connected, you can then attach the other end of the hose to your air compressor. Test Your Connections

If you’re wondering how to connect an air compressor to a hose reel, the process is straightforward and easy to follow. To start, ensure that your compressor and hose reel both have fitting sizes that are compatible. This is important because mismatched sizes can lead to leaks and reduced efficiency.

Next, locate the air outlet on your compressor and attach a coupler to it. Then, connect the other end of the coupler to the intake port on the hose reel. Once you’ve made this connection, double-check for any air leaks before turning on your compressor.

An easy way to do this is by applying soapy water to the fittings and watching for bubbles. By following these simple steps, you can confidently connect your air compressor to your hose reel and get your work done smoothly and efficiently.

FAQs

What is an air compressor hose reel?
An air compressor hose reel is a device used to store and dispense an air compressor hose, typically used in a workshop or garage setting.

How do you connect an air compressor hose to a reel?
To connect an air compressor hose to a reel, first, identify the inflow and outflow ports on the reel. Then, attach one end of the hose to the inflow port on the reel and the other end to the air compressor.

Can any type of air compressor hose be used with a reel?
It is important to ensure that the air compressor hose being used with a reel is the correct size and type for the compressor and application. Always consult the manufacturer’s recommendations.

How do you properly store an air compressor hose on a reel?
To properly store an air compressor hose on a reel, first, make sure the hose is free of any kinks or bends. Then, wrap the hose evenly around the reel, being careful not to overlap or twist the hose.

What are the benefits of using an air compressor hose reel?
Using an air compressor hose reel can help to keep your workspace organized and tidy, as well as prolonging the life of your air compressor hose by preventing kinking and other forms of damage.

Can a hose reel be used with multiple air compressors?
Yes, a hose reel can be used with multiple air compressors, provided that they are all compatible with the hose being used and the necessary connections are made.

How do you maintain an air compressor hose reel?
To maintain an air compressor hose reel, regularly inspect the hose for any signs of damage or wear and tear. Also, keep the reel clean and free of dirt and debris, and store it in a dry, climate-controlled environment.
